Seaweed
Seaweed banks play a vital role in marine ecosystems, functioning similarly to seagrass meadows.
While often found in rocky substrates, certain seaweed species like Caulerpa are capable of colonizing sandy areas, stabilizing sediments that were once considered "marine deserts."
This ability to establish habitats in previously barren environments allows a wide variety of organisms to thrive, turning the sea floor into a submerged forest, even in the most unexpected places.

Seaweed habitats face significant threats
These seaweed ecosystems are currently being lost in many regions due to various pressures, including climate change-induced heatwaves, pollution, and fishing activities. These factors compromise the health of seaweed forests, with potentially devastating impacts on marine biodiversity and the ecosystem services
The need to protect and restore marine forests is urgent
Restoring seaweed habitats is essential for maintaining ocean biodiversity, supporting climate change solutions, but also for their role as nurseries and refuges for many marine species, some of which are vital for fisheries.
